For as long as we can remember, the name Lil Wayne and Cash Money have been synonymous. However, it looks like that association may be coming to an end.

Weezy took to Twitter to blast the label for refusing to release his album. Considering how deeply personal his relationship with the label and label head Baby has always been — this isn’t your average label/artist feud. Wayne signed with Cash Money Records when he was 11 years old and has been rocking with them ever since.
